Treatment of ocular disease

ActiveUS12673045B2DiseasePatient acceptance
The present invention is in the field of ocular disease therapy. In particular, the invention relates to a composition comprising pimecrolimus for use in the topical treatment of moderate to severe blepharitis, in particular in a patient group comprising subjects with a clinical diagnosis of moderate to severe blepharitis, wherein the subjects to be treated have signs and symptoms of moderate to severe blepharitis characterised by swelling of the eyelid margin, ocular debris and ocular discomfort. In particular, the present invention relates to an ophthalmic composition that shows a high patient acceptance and a clinically meaningful improvement in the signs and symptoms of treated patients.

Composition for ophthalmic use containing sepetaprost

PendingUS20260183309A1OphthalmologyBiology
A method for stabilizing a composition for ophthalmic use containing sepetaprost is disclosed. More specifically, a method that facilitates retention of sepetaprost stability at high temperatures, and further, a method that facilitates the retention of preservative effectiveness of the composition for ophthalmic use are disclosed. The composition for ophthalmic use contains sepetaprost at a concentration of 0.0001 to 0.003% (w / v) and has a pH within a range from 5 to 8.

Operation of LEDs in ophthalmic instruments

An ophthalmic instrument is equipped with LEDs (6). In addition to the LEDs (6), the instrument has a voltage source (B), an inductor (L), and a capacitor (C). The method for operating the instrument comprises at least one charging sequence (Z1) and one illumination sequence (Z2). The charging sequence includes at least a first and at least a second phase (P1, P2). In the first phase (P1), the voltage source (B) and the inductor (L) are connected in series. In the second phase (P2), the inductor (L) and the capacitor (C) are connected in series. The illumination sequence (Z2) comprises at least a third and at least a fourth phase. In the third phase (P3), the LED(s) (6), the inductor (L), and the capacitor (C) are connected in series. In the fourth phase (P4), the LED(s) and the inductor (L) are connected in series. In the charging sequence (Z1), the inductor (L) serves to transfer energy from the voltage source (B) to the capacitor (C).In the lighting sequence, the coil (L) is used for current regulation or control of the LEDs (6).

Lanosterol derivative, and preparation method and use thereof

PendingAU2025346046A1LanosterolDisease
The present application relates to the technical field of medicine and provides a lanosterol derivative, a preparation method therefor and a use thereof. The structural formula of the lanosterol derivative provided by the present application is as shown in formula I or II. The lanosterol derivative provided by the present application has both lipid solubility and water solubility, and can effectively penetrate into the pathological site in the body, thereby improving the drug utilization rate. The results of embodiments show that the lanosterol derivative provided by the present application has a significantly higher solubility in water than lanosterol or 25-hydroxylanosterol and shows a significant therapeutic effect on a cataract in animal in vivo experiments. Therefore, the derivative has wide prospects in the preparation of drugs for treating eye diseases or conditions.
